Governor Abbott And AG Paxton Urge President Trump To Authorize FEMA Disaster Assistance For Houses Of Worship In Wake Of Hurricane Harvey
Governor Greg Abbott and Attorney General Ken Paxton today sent a letter to President Trump, urging him to ensure that churches and other religious organizations are treated equally with other nonprofits and not excluded from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A) disaster funding for victims of Hurricane Harvey.
Governor Abbott Praises Debris Removal Efforts By TxDOT
Governor Greg Abbott today announced that TxDOT has removed approximately 432,000 cubic feet (8 football fields) of debris from city and county roadways in the aftermath of Hurricane Harvey.
